INTERPROVINCIAL NEWS

[PBB UKITBD PBBSS ASSOCIATION. Wellington, This Day The race horse Billy, hurt in the Iferetannga Handicap at the Hutt meeting, had to be shot. The Dunedin Star states that the Wool Growers Company's Prospectus has been withdrawn from the London market Robert Bathgate, one of the crew lost lin the Taiaroa, leaves a wife and six children in Glasgow. Gisboknb, April 16. A man named J. Calvey has died from injuries supposed to have been received while riding one horse and leading another. He was evidently dragged off bne horse by the other one mto the river, /pad stepped on by one of the animals. Auckland, April 17. The Puruhia cheese factory, between Hamilton and Ohaupo, was destroyed by fire at 1 o'clcck this morning. It is not known yet whether the cheese, valued at £600, was insured. Dunedin, April 17. It is understood that the Waimea Plains Railway Company have refused the offer of the Government to purckase the line. Blenheim, Ibis Day. The inquest on Whittington Lane, who wag accidentally shot at Havelock on Sunday morning, resulted in a verdict of accidental death. The jury censured the doctor for ordering the removal of the deceased to BUnheim, while in such an exhausted state. sad in. suck weather.
